    My local trails. Great fact about Vietnam, this was the first property ever privately purchased by a mountain biking association in the US. On a few occasions, developers have offered well over $1m to purchase the parcel. But NEMBA has rejected all offers to sell. It’s a pretty great story for all of us locals !

    It was named Vietnam, if I recall, because the first MTB riders who were out there in the '90s thought it was like riding in a warzone due to the super technical, rocky, and jungle like riding. I grew up about 20 minutes from there and first rode it in ~03/04? Some of the old features are long gone, swamp drop, the big spider, golden gate, etc, there used to be some totally hairy old stuff there and the new stuff looks great, haven't ridden there since 2010, sounds like its time for a trip east with the bike!

    There was a trail sign back when it was built and ridden by dirt bikes next to the power lines that only a few remember that said "Vietnam". It's long gone but the name stuck. The sign was still there in the early 1990's when these were the most technical, narrow pure singletrack trails in central MA.
